Dozens Of Students Positive For COVID-19, Purbalingga Regent Stops Face-to-Face Learning

PURBALINGGA - The Regency Government (Pemkab) of Purbalingga, Central Java has temporarily suspended limited face-to-face learning activities (PTM). The district government evaluates the readiness of health protocols, following 90 positive COVID-19 students.

"For the time being, all limited PTM implementations will be suspended until further evaluation is carried out," said Purbalingga Regent Dyah Hayuning Pratiwi, quoted by Antara, Tuesday, September 21.

The regent said the decision was taken following 90 students of SMPN 4 Mrebet, Purbalingga Regency who are currently undergoing centralized isolation in the school building because their rapid antigen test results showed positive for COVID-19.

This condition was discovered after a mass antigen test activity was held by the local puskesmas team to support face-to-face learning.

"Based on the information we received, from about 300 students, it turned out that 90 of them had a positive antigen test result," he said.

The Regent said, related to this, his party would conduct a thorough evaluation and ensure the readiness of the health protocol before restarting limited PTM activities.

"Thus, it is hoped that it will minimize the potential or risk of transmitting COVID-19," he said.

The Regent added that so far his party had made strict rules for the implementation of limited PTM.

"For example, by carrying out mass antigen tests before the implementation of limited PTM, vaccinating teaching staff and also ensuring the readiness of implementing health protocols in schools," he said.

However, in the future it will make more detailed and stricter rules related to the implementation of PTM.

"Therefore, for further preparation, PTM activities are limited to being temporarily suspended, please be patient, keep the spirit to maintain health and discipline and the application of health protocols must continue to be strengthened," he said.

The Regent of Purbalingga said that at this time his party was continuing to take quick steps and coordinating with all relevant parties in order to deal with 90 students of SMPN 4 Mrebet whose antigen rapid test results showed positive.

"Of course we will take quick steps, we also direct the 90 children to undergo centralized isolation in the school building," he said.

The condition of these students is currently fine and asymptomatic.

"However, isolation is still being carried out to facilitate further handling, and the next PCR test will also be carried out on the 90 students. So later after the PCR test results come out, those with positive PCR test results will continue centralized isolation," he said.

The parents or guardians of the 90 students were asked to remain calm as their children remain under the close supervision of the health team.

"The Purbalingga COVID-19 Task Force Team has taken quick steps and prepared all facilities and infrastructure and optimal handling steps," he said.
